姑姑
ㄍㄨ ㄍㄨ
“paternal aunt; father's sister; (Taiwan) a young woman; nun or Taoist nun”

Words sharing these characters
Vocabulary built from the same character — most common first
- 姑娘ㄍㄨ ㄋㄧㄤˊgirl; young woman; young lady; daughter; (archaic) paternal aunt; (archaic) concubine; (archaic) prostitute.
- 姑且ㄍㄨ ㄑㄧㄝˇfor the time being; tentatively; provisionally; as a temporary measure
- 小姑娘ㄒㄧㄠˇ ㄍㄨ ˙ㄋㄧㄤlittle girl; young unmarried woman
- 姑媽ㄍㄨ ㄇㄚfather's sister; aunt
- 尼姑ㄋㄧˊ ㄍㄨBuddhist nun; woman who has taken religious vows
- 小姑ㄒㄧㄠˇ ㄍㄨhusband's younger sister; father's youngest sister; young girl; young female priestess
- 灰姑娘ㄏㄨㄟ ㄍㄨ ㄋㄧㄤˊCinderella; European folk tale of a mistreated girl who rises to fortune; a plain girl transformed into someone admired
- 姑息ㄍㄨ ㄒㄧˊto appease; to indulge; to be overly lenient; to compromise unprincipledly for temporary peace
- 師姑ㄕ ㄍㄨBuddhist nun
- 姑丈ㄍㄨ ㄓㄤˋhusband of paternal aunt; uncle by marriage (father's sister's husband).
